          At the moment, it does require the ability to click the play button upon launch. I’m looking into a workaround for that.

          As it turns out, the simple addition of ?autoplay=1 to the url gives the video stream the ability to auto start. So, no need to click anything. I love google! First search and the solution was right there! :thumbsup:
